Based on the following information, calculate the sustainable growth rate for Kovalev’s Kickboxing:
Profit margin = 9.2%
Capital intensity ratio = .60
Debt-equity ratio = .50
Net income = $23,000
Dividends = $14,000
What is the ROE here?
